Scago Educational Facilities Corporation For Union School Distr
| Fiscal year | Revenue | Expenses | Net | Reserve mo. | Staff % |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2011 | 685,171 | 2,009,381 | −1,324,210 | -7.1 | 0% |
| 2012 | 686,450 | 2,437,591 | −1,751,141 | -14.4 | 0% |
| 2017 | 1,970,252 | 1,285,844 | 684,408 | 7.2 | 0% |
| 2018 | 2,758,543 | 1,257,465 | 1,501,078 | 21.6 | 0% |
| 2019 | 2,779,480 | 1,272,149 | 1,507,331 | 35.6 | 0% |
| 2020 | 2,684,240 | 1,115,899 | 1,568,341 | 57.9 | 0% |
| 2021 | 2,708,613 | 1,031,869 | 1,676,744 | 82.1 | 0% |
| 2022 | 2,721,141 | 946,733 | 1,774,408 | 112.0 | 0% |
| 2023 | 2,717,315 | 860,511 | 1,856,804 | 149.1 | 0% |
In its most recent public year (2023), this organization brought in $1,856,804 more than it spent. Its reserves stood at about 149.1 months of spending, up from -7.1 in 2011. Staff pay was 0% of spending.
Reserve months = net assets ÷ average monthly spending; net assets count everything the organization owns beyond its debts — buildings and donor-restricted funds included, not just cash. Staff pay = salaries, wages, and officer compensation; it excludes benefits and payroll taxes. The IRS releases this data years after the fact — this organization's newest public year is 2023.
